org.springframework.faces.support
Class ResponseStateManagerWrapper
java.lang.Object
javax.faces.render.ResponseStateManager
org.springframework.faces.support.ResponseStateManagerWrapper
- All Implemented Interfaces:
- javax.faces.FacesWrapper<javax.faces.render.ResponseStateManager>
- Direct Known Subclasses:
- FlowResponseStateManager
public abstract class ResponseStateManagerWrapper
- extends javax.faces.render.ResponseStateManager
- implements javax.faces.FacesWrapper<javax.faces.render.ResponseStateManager>
Provides a simple implementation of ResponseStateManager
that can be subclassed by developers wishing to
provide specialized behavior to an existing instance
. The default implementation of all
methods is to call through to the wrapped ResponseStateManager
.
- Since:
- 2.4
- Author:
- Phillip Webb
Fields inherited from class javax.faces.render.ResponseStateManager |
RENDER_KIT_ID_PARAM, VIEW_STATE_PARAM |
Method Summary |
java.lang.Object |
getComponentStateToRestore(javax.faces.context.FacesContext context)
Deprecated. |
java.lang.Object |
getState(javax.faces.context.FacesContext context,
java.lang.String viewId)
|
java.lang.Object |
getTreeStructureToRestore(javax.faces.context.FacesContext context,
java.lang.String viewId)
Deprecated. |
java.lang.String |
getViewState(javax.faces.context.FacesContext context,
java.lang.Object state)
|
abstract javax.faces.render.ResponseStateManager |
getWrapped()
|
boolean |
isPostback(javax.faces.context.FacesContext context)
|
void |
writeState(javax.faces.context.FacesContext context,
java.lang.Object state)
|
void |
writeState(javax.faces.context.FacesContext context,
javax.faces.application.StateManager.SerializedView state)
Deprecated. |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
ResponseStateManagerWrapper
public ResponseStateManagerWrapper()
getWrapped
public abstract javax.faces.render.ResponseStateManager getWrapped()
- Specified by:
getWrapped
in interface javax.faces.FacesWrapper<javax.faces.render.ResponseStateManager>
writeState
public void writeState(javax.faces.context.FacesContext context,
java.lang.Object state)
throws java.io.IOException
- Overrides:
writeState
in class javax.faces.render.ResponseStateManager
- Throws:
java.io.IOException
writeState
@Deprecated
public void writeState(javax.faces.context.FacesContext context,
javax.faces.application.StateManager.SerializedView state)
throws java.io.IOException
- Deprecated.
- Overrides:
writeState
in class javax.faces.render.ResponseStateManager
- Throws:
java.io.IOException
getState
public java.lang.Object getState(javax.faces.context.FacesContext context,
java.lang.String viewId)
- Overrides:
getState
in class javax.faces.render.ResponseStateManager
getTreeStructureToRestore
@Deprecated
public java.lang.Object getTreeStructureToRestore(javax.faces.context.FacesContext context,
java.lang.String viewId)
- Deprecated.
- Overrides:
getTreeStructureToRestore
in class javax.faces.render.ResponseStateManager
getComponentStateToRestore
@Deprecated
public java.lang.Object getComponentStateToRestore(javax.faces.context.FacesContext context)
- Deprecated.
- Overrides:
getComponentStateToRestore
in class javax.faces.render.ResponseStateManager
isPostback
public boolean isPostback(javax.faces.context.FacesContext context)
- Overrides:
isPostback
in class javax.faces.render.ResponseStateManager
getViewState
public java.lang.String getViewState(javax.faces.context.FacesContext context,
java.lang.Object state)
- Overrides:
getViewState
in class javax.faces.render.ResponseStateManager